    Abstract: Provided is a method of producing a glass, including, in order to obtain an excellent refining effect: preparing a raw glass batch including: an antimony compound containing pentavalent antimony; and an oxidizing agent (a cerium oxide, a sulfate, a nitrate); and melting the raw glass batch. In preparing the raw glass batch, it is preferable that the antimony compound be premixed with the oxidizing agent. When the nitrate is used as the oxidizing agent, the raw glass batch is prepared so as to include the antimony compound in an amount of more than 0.5 parts by mass and at most 3 parts by mass, in terms of an amount of antimony pentoxide, per 100 parts by mass of a base glass composition expressed in terms of an amount of an oxide.

    Abstract: A glass substrate for a display, which is formed of a glass having a light weight and having high refinability with decreasing environmental burdens, the glass comprising, by mass %, 50 to 70% of SiO2, 5 to 18% of B2O3, 10 to 25% of Al2O3, 0 to 10% of MgO, 0 to 20% of CaO, 0 to 20% of SrO, 0 to 10% of BaO, 5 to 20% of RO (in which R is at least one member selected from the group consisting of Mg, Ca, Sr and Ba), and over 0.20% but not more than 2.0% of R?2O (in which R? is at least one member selected from the group consisting of Li, Na and K), and containing, by mass %, 0.05 to 1.5% of oxide of metal that changes in valence number in a molten glass, and substantially containing none of As2O3, Sb2O3 and PbO.

    Abstract: When a glass substrate for a liquid crystal display is manufactured using the downdraw method. strain caused by differences in the tempsrature of the sheet glass achieved as a result of cooling are reduced. Furth rtore. minute strain that occurs when the sheet glass manufactured using the downdraw method is out into smaller pieces is inhibited. When the sheet glass 8 is manufactured using the downdraw method. a temperature distribution is formed in the widthwise direction of the sheet glass 8 by the heat treating unit 9 used in the slowly cooling process after molding. This temperature distribution is a distribution that can offset the temperature distribution in the sheet glass 8 caused by the fact that the thickness of the sheet glass 8 after molding is greater in the edge areas than that in the surface area.
